FRIENDS OF THE UFFIZI GALLERY

On May 27, 1993, a bomb exploded on via dei Georgofili, in Florence, seriously damaging the Uffizi Gallery and several important works of art inside.  The Association came into existence on July 8 with the immediate goal of establishing a direct line between private citizens, companies, organisations, etc. desirous of contributing to repairing the damage, and the Gallery direction, which could therefore count on immediately available funds.  The Association also took shape, however, in the broader perspective of supporting and promoting all the initiatives and activities, the implementation of which requires the flexibility that only a private association can have. "To demonstrate the supremacy of culture over barbarity.":  this is the raison d'être of the “Friends of the Uffizi Association”, which was formed on July 9, 1993, following the via dei Georgofili bombing, perpetrated on May 27 of that same year. Its founders include personalities tied to the Uffizi, as well as private citizens, businessmen and institutions, which through the Association intend to offer the entire world, the possibility to contribute to the preservation and growth of the great patrimony that is the Uffizi Gallery. The Association has an international vocation, and intends to operate inspired by the analogous associations which support the world’s major museums. The first actions of the “Friends of the Uffizi” were aimed at restoring the damage caused by the May 27, 1993 bombing.  In parallel, the Association has undertaken a further series of actions of an importance and breadth, closely tied to the resources made available by the contributions of the “Friends of the Uffizi”. Friends of the Uffizi” is an Association which draws its resources exclusively from the voluntary contributions of individuals, institutions, organisations, businesses and other associations, both Italian and international, that share its purpose.  It has been recognised by the regional government of Tuscany as an ONLUS Association (non profit-making organisation of social utility). Its primary purpose is to promote all the initiatives of a cultural, service or other nature which can contribute to making the Uffizi Gallery known, prized and valorised. It intends to perform divulgative, educational and promotional activities in favour of the Uffizi.  Its commitments include promoting the publication of catalogues, reproductions, illustrative materials and books, as well as incrementing the Museum’s library and photographic records. Moreover, it seeks to promote the collection of funds to destine to the purchase of artworks to donate to the Uffizi, and to employ furthermore for the maintenance, protection, conservation and restoration of the existing collections.
